About the job

This job is an exciting opportunity for an experienced lawyer to join MinterEllison's Perth Dispute Resolution and Insurance team. Working closely with a nationally recognised leader in insurance law, you will engage with a diverse client base and tackle complex insurance and liability disputes. The team fosters a collaborative environment that values excellence, diversity, and innovation, empowering you to grow your career while making a meaningful impact.
